For the third consecutive year, Detroit-based Bridgewater Interiors L.L.C. remains the nation’s third-largest black-owned company. Since moving up 19 places on the BE Industrial/Service Companies list from No. 22 in 2005, the company has earned the recognition of being a BE 100s top employment and sales leader. As a joint venture between automotive supplier Johnson Controls and Detroit-based Epsilon L.L.C., Bridgewater Interiors produces seating and interior systems for some of the nation’s leading automakers including Ford Motor Co., who awarded the minority auto supplier a groundbreaking $500 million annual contract in 2003. Since its inception in 1998, Bridgewater Interiors has grossed more than $1 billion in revenues and expanded its enterprise to incorporate a manufacturing firm in Warren, Michigan. 00:35:00Diverse Businessnoron hall,minority business,joint venture jci,black enterprise,supplier diversity louis greenHear RonHall, Jr.  Vice President & General Counsel at Bridgewater Interiors, LLC. They are Amazon, Apple, Facebook, and Google. Yes, these companies excel via their superior use of technology. They have built incredible ecosystems. They’ve embraced partnerships and external innovation. Beyond all of this, The Gang of Four has embraced an entirely new way of doing business: the platform. A platform is simply a set of integrated planks. The most powerful platforms today have two things in common: ♦ They are rooted in equally powerful technologies—and their intelligent usage. In other words, they differ from traditional platforms in that they are not predicated on physical assets, land, and natural resources. ♦ They benefit tremendously from vibrant ecosystems (read: partners, developers, users, customers, and communities). While platforms inhere a great deal of potential commercial appeal and applications, they do not exist simply as a means for companies to hawk their wares. At their core, platforms today are primarily about consumer utility and communications. Follow her onInbound Marketing Explained: Ryan Carrigghttp://www.blogtalkradio.com/diversebusiness/2011/07/11/inbound-marketing-explained-ryan-carriggBusinesshttp://www.blogtalkradio.com/diversebusiness/2011/07/11/inbound-marketing-explained-ryan-carrigg/#commentshttp://www.blogtalkradio.com/diversebusiness/2011/07/11/inbound-marketing-explained-ryan-carriggMon, 11 Jul 2011 22:00:00 GMTInbound Marketing Explained: Ryan CarriggInbound marketing is a marketing strategy that focuses on getting found by customers. This sense is related to relationship marketing and Seth Godin's idea of permission marketing. David Meerman Scott recommends that marketers "earn their way in" (via publishing helpful information on a blog etc.) in contrast to outbound marketing where they used to have to "buy, beg, or bug their way in" (via paid advertisements, issuing press releases in the hope they get picked up by the trade press, or paying commissioned sales people, respectively). Brian Halligan, cofounder and CEO of HubSpot, claimed coined the term in this sense. This show we have Inbound Marketing Specialist, Ryan Carrigg from Hubspot to explain this new marketing method. As a practice, Relationship Marketing differs from other forms of marketing in that it recognizes the long term value of customer relationships and extends communication beyond intrusive advertising and sales promotional messages. With the growth of the internet and mobile platforms, Relationship Marketing has continued to evolve and move forward as technology opens more collaborative and social communication channels. This includes tools for managing relationships with customers that goes beyond simple demographic and customer service data. Relationship Marketing extends to include Inbound Marketing efforts, (a combination of search optimization and Strategic Content), PR, Social Media and Application Development. 00:36:00Diverse Businessnorelationship marketing,louis green,diversity,mmsdc,search marketingBusiness is based on relationships!
